Preguntas frecuentes: Disgusting vs Offensive
¿Cuál es la diferencia entre Disgusting y Offensive?
Disgusting: Something very unpleasant or makes you feel sick. Offensive: Something that causes upset or hurt feelings.
¿Puedes mostrar un ejemplo de cada una?
Disgusting: The taste of the spoiled milk was absolutely disgusting. Offensive: His comments were so offensive that they made several audience members uncomfortable.
¿Puedo usar Disgusting y Offensive indistintamente?
No siempre. Disgusting y Offensive están relacionadas y a veces se solapan, pero difieren en registro, frecuencia y uso, así que cambiar una por otra puede alterar el significado o el tono. Revisa las diferencias de arriba antes de sustituir.
